HERE'S THE STORY:

Building a new school will turn around the lives of more street children

Vatsalya rescues orphans from the streets of India, providing education and job skills so that they grow up as citizens equipped to give back to their communities. You can help fund a new, expanded school that will amplify their ability to reverse the negative cycle of poverty into a positive cycle of empowerment.
 
For ten years Vatsalya has grown into a refined and tested program. But the existing small school buildings at Udayan impose bottlenecks on the full potential of the program. The new school will provide expanded facilities that can properly support Vatsalya's work, enhance their efficiency and effectiveness, and allow more community outreach. It will include ten more classrooms, a science lab, a library, and a store.
 

Everyone at Vatsalya feels so strongly about the need for this project that the staff and older students are donating their own time and labor toward the construction of their school.

About the work of Vatsalya

At their peaceful, rural Udayan campus outside Jaipur, India, Vatsalya rehabilitates orphans through a holistic program built around strong core values. The orphans receive an education, including math, Hindi, English, arts and music. The children also learn practical trade skills so that they can get a job when they graduate. They learn community values, such as how to respect others, resolve conflicts, and get along. Some children require therapy to overcome the often severe traumas of urban street life in India.
